Use trusted payment methods

Every online and mobile casino uses payment methods in order for you to deposit money to play and withdraw money that you have won. It is highly advised to use trusted payment methods such as PayPal, Visa/Mastercard, Skrill, Neteller and EcoPayz to name a few.

The reason it’s so important to use a trusted payment provider is because when you make payments with any platform, you are potentially giving access to your personal information.

All of the platforms above are heavily encrypted to ensure your data is not able to be leaked or collected. Using unverified or untrusted payment platforms can lead to your personal information, such as your online banking details, email address and passwords being collected.

Use verified apps

As well as using trusted payment methods, choose verified casino apps. When you install an application on your smartphone, you have to allow the app to access certain features of your phone.

Before installing an app, read through the permissions they require and check if the app has been verified. You might be installing an app that has the ability to read your screen and collect your personal information.

Unverified casino apps also haven’t been regulated for payout percentages and Random Number Generation, which means you may never win playing these apps.

Play in a safe area

While it is very convenient to open an app, anywhere at any time due to the advancements in technology, however this can be quite a security concern. It is also very efficient to load the webpage of the online casino and not have to enter your username and password every time.

Automatic log in makes it very easy to just start playing wherever you are, but that also means if your phone gets stolen, anyone can access your account. They could then either gamble on your device using your money, or even gain access to your bank account. Smartphone theft has been on the rise with 70 million being stolen each year.

Check gambling registers

Another resource that is freely available for you to peruse are gambling registers. You can find these registers online with a quick internet search. When an online casino or app is verified, it means that they have certified gambling licenses.

There are many providers such as Malta Gaming Authority, Gambling Commission, Swedish Gambling Authority and eCOGRA. It is important that the app or online casino is licensed as licensed platforms are heavily scrutinized before being given a license to ensure that play is fair.

You don’t want to be giving money away with no chance of winning anything back.
